Problems with universal scraper. - mctrollstein - 2013-02-26 Universal scraper doesn't ask the user to clarify when it comes across a movie of which it is unsure of the title. I'm getting a lot of movies that are either just skipped entirely and don't show up or have the completely wrong content set. It's not very convenient to cross-reference the data folder with the movie list in xbmc to ensure each movie has been set correctly. The old IMDB scraper would allow you to choose from a list when it was unsure of a correct title. Is there anyway that I can get Universal Scraper to alert me when it encounters a movie file it can't match to a title? I have all movie in folders named with the movie title and year. RE: Problems with universal scraper. - olympia - 2013-02-28 It has never ever done this on automatic bulk scraping. It is doing this only if you manually refresh a movie from within the movie info dialog. RE: Problems with universal scraper. - mctrollstein - 2013-02-28 Maybe I'm mistaken. Thanks. |
